Kind of a shame the non-roadworthy/non-repairable ones are not sold in such a way that they could be cannibalized, and the remaining frames/cab, residue could be destroyed under witness of either CADC or DND. There will be hundreds of these vehicles in Cdn civilian hands (although the plan now is to retain both the LSVW and the HLVW until 2025) and there are no real sources of spare parts for them. If these were sold individually or in smaller lots of 2 or 3 strictly for salvage, I suspect they could fetch much better than scrap prices.
This would be better for the collector market, as well as for the DND. |
